Is the Changan JL476ZQCF a Blue Whale Engine?

4 Answers
DelEdward
09/06/25 5:24am

The Changan JL476ZQCF model engine is a Blue Whale engine. More information about the Blue Whale engine is as follows: 1. It is an engine independently developed by Changan Automobile, utilizing advanced production technology. Based on the engine's power parameters, its maximum torque output speed ranges between 1,750-3,500 rpm. 2. With modular top-level design, the Blue Whale NE power platform is compatible with 1.0-1.8L displacements, achieving a 98% commonality rate. While meeting the China 6b emission standards, the Blue Whale NE power platform is preset with an upgrade path for Euro 7 standards. Combined with a lightweight technology index of 3.0Nm/kg, the entire series is compatible with 48V, HEV, PHEV, and REEV designs, embracing the era of electrification.

SanLincoln
12/15/25 5:49am

Yes, the JL476ZQCF belongs to the BlueCore series. Having serviced many Changan vehicles, this engine is commonly found in CS75 or Oshan models. Its characteristics include durability and fewer faults. During routine maintenance, checking the engine oil and filter is straightforward, and the OBD diagnostic system helps quickly identify issues. Customer feedback highlights high fuel efficiency, saving more on fuel costs compared to traditional engines. Parts are interchangeable and easy to replace. It also boasts good safety performance with reduced emissions. Overall, maintenance costs are reasonable, making it a reliable choice.

Can't the Brake Be Depressed When the Car Battery Is Dead?

When the car battery is dead, the brake cannot be depressed. The reasons why the brake cannot be depressed are as follows: 1. Air in the brake fluid line: Brake fluid is the medium for transmitting force in the braking system. If air enters the fluid line, the brake fluid under high pressure will appear insufficient in strength. Although there is still braking force, the maximum braking force is significantly weakened. In this case, the braking system should be promptly bled at a repair shop. 2. Brake fluid not replaced for a long time: If the brake fluid is not replaced in time, it will contain excessive impurities and moisture, which will affect the transmission of braking force. 3. Oil leakage or overly soft brake material: Generally, oil leakage from the brake master cylinder or brake fluid line will cause the vehicle's brake to become soft. If the brake material is too soft, its high-temperature stability will deteriorate, which will also cause the vehicle's brake to become soft.

What Causes Water Leakage in the Rear Seats of a Car?

The specific reasons for water leakage in the rear seats of a car are as follows: 1. Poor sealing of the trunk rubber strip leading to water leakage. 2. Blockage of the drainage holes in the trunk lid causing water to leak into the rear seats. 3. Poor sealing of the tail lights resulting in water leakage into the rear seats. 4. Inadequate sealing of the drainage holes beneath the spare tire well leading to water leakage into the rear seats. Solutions: 1. Clear the drainage holes: If you hear noticeable water sounds when opening/closing doors or while driving, it indicates water accumulation in the trunk. Simply use a thin wire or small screwdriver to clear the drainage holes. 2. Replace the sealing strips: Replace the sealing strips for the trunk and rear doors to enhance the car's sealing and prevent further water leakage. 3. Visit a 4S shop for inspection and repair.

Can uneven car touch-up paint be sanded?

If the car touch-up paint is not smooth after application, it can be sanded. Below is more information about car touch-up paint: 1. Process: The specific steps for touch-up paint include determining the repair area, assessing the damage level, applying protective measures, surface preparation, masking and degreasing, applying base coat, applying clear coat, blending the edges, baking, and finally sanding and polishing the paint surface. If loss of gloss occurs during polishing, it can be restored using a high-speed polisher with specialized polishing compound. 2. Precautions: The hardness of the touch-up paint is lower compared to the original factory paint, and high water pressure can damage the car's paint surface, so avoid using high-pressure water jets directly on the car body.

What Causes a Car Sunroof to Leak?

Car sunroof leakage can be attributed to the following reasons: 1. Clogged sunroof drainage outlets: When the drainage outlets are blocked, rainwater cannot flow smoothly and gradually seeps into the car. This issue mainly occurs when the owner neglects regular cleaning of the roof, allowing debris to flow with rainwater into the drainage outlets and clog them. To address this, you can use a wire to create a hook and remove the debris from the drainage holes, or visit a repair shop to use an air gun to blow out the debris. 2. Damaged sunroof seal: The sunroof seal is made of rubber and can deteriorate over time due to aging and repeated friction from the sunroof glass, leading to poor sealing and leaks during rainy weather. Regular inspection of the seal's condition is necessary, and damaged seals should be replaced promptly with high-performance, aging- and corrosion-resistant options. 3. Roof deformation: If the car is involved in a collision, the body may deform. If the repair is not done properly, the sealing may not be restored, resulting in leaks. During the repair of accident-damaged cars, it is essential to strictly adhere to the original vehicle standards to prevent mismatched parts and potential leakage issues.

What is the maximum allowable size for a car spoiler modification?

Car spoiler modifications must not exceed 300mm. Below is an introduction regarding illegal modifications: 1. Penalties: Driving an illegally modified vehicle on public roads will result in the vehicle being impounded by traffic authorities, confiscation of illegal modifications, orders to restore the vehicle to its original condition, and legal fines. 2. Regulations: Vehicles with illegal modifications will not be issued a safety inspection compliance certificate by traffic authorities. If the modifications constitute a violation of public security management laws, public security authorities may impose fines, detention, or other penalties in accordance with the "Public Security Administration Punishment Law." When modifying your vehicle, it is essential to apply for a modification registration with the traffic management department of the public security authorities to ensure the vehicle can pass annual inspections and routine safety checks after modification.

What are the penalty items for ramp driving?

Penalty items for ramp parking are as follows: 1. Vehicle starting: (1) If the vehicle rolls back 10-30 cm after starting, 10 points will be deducted. (2) If the vehicle rolls back more than 30 cm after starting, the test will be failed. 2. Vehicle stopping: (1) If the front bumper of the car or the front axle of the motorcycle is not aligned with the pole line after stopping, and the deviation exceeds 50 cm, it will be considered a failure. (2) If the front bumper of the car or the front axle of the motorcycle is not aligned with the pole line after stopping, but the deviation does not exceed 50 cm, 10 points will be deducted (previously 20 points). (3) If the vehicle body is more than 30 cm away from the road edge line after stopping but does not exceed 50 cm, 10 points will be deducted (previously 20 points). (4) If the vehicle body is more than 50 cm away from the road edge line after stopping, 100 points will be deducted. 3. Other penalty items: (1) If the engine stalls once due to improper operation, 10 points will be deducted. (2) If the parking brake is not tightened after stopping, 10 points will be deducted. (3) If the vehicle rides or presses the solid edge line of the road while driving, it will be considered a failure.
